Output faae1bd629b8486545d4f4cb113dcfddb54d58ff6fc5d6daa0e8899ca2daa384:29

value
28640
script pubkey
OP_0 OP_PUSHBYTES_20 6a9ce8827c9cfa3b4e7c16eb7086aba99fde0075
address
bc1qd2ww3qnunnarknnuzm4hpp4t4x0auqr4vdvyzt
transaction
faae1bd629b8486545d4f4cb113dcfddb54d58ff6fc5d6daa0e8899ca2daa384
confirmations
264348
spent
true